Most cats are not very fond of car travel. Part of the reason is that by nature they are territorial and prefer to rule their kingdom, also known as your home. They have a routine; a schedule and they stick to it. Removing them from their comfort zone can be extremely stressful.

Ever want to give back when traveling in the world of need? Love to take photos? Then join Dog Meets World, the photo diplomacy project and help connect cultures through the power of photography. The ambitious mission of Dog Meets World (DMW) is to give all children/families in developing countries personal photographs, often for the first time. DMW seeks to change the way people see others and rather than simply taking pictures, to give them as well.
